REFINEMENT WAS INITIATED BY PROLSQ, WHICH DID NOT ALLOW ANISOTROPY. THE FINAL REFINEMENT WAS CARRIED OUT USING SHELX-L93 WITH ALL ATOMS ANISOTROPIC.
THE PRESENCE OF THE 17 IODIDE ATOMS MAKES THE APPLICATION
OF THE USUAL ANALYSIS OF ERRORS NOT VALID. ONLY WHEN
ANOTHER MONOCLINIC LYSOZYME STRUCTURE WITHOUT HEAVY ATOMS
HAS BEEN REFINED BY THE SAME PROCEDURE WILL AN ANALYSIS
BE POSSIBLE. NEVERTHELESS, A COMPARISON OF THE BOND
LENGTHS BETWEEN THE TWO MOLECULES OF LYSOZYME GIVES AN
AVERAGE ERROR OF 0.12 ANGSTROMS, WHICH IS IN GOOD AGREEMENT
WITH THE LUZATTI ANALYSIS.
